Transaction 857500981faa3a4bb75cd0db61eb410b4a8bf6cdf664767854d8880bbb58f699
1 Input
1 Output
-
857500981faa3a4bb75cd0db61eb410b4a8bf6cdf664767854d8880bbb58f699:0
- value
- 2388597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6110ecc73c95969a88fc75863ca70a1cb59984f2 OP_EQUAL
- address
- 3AYFk7dBuZgdCyNkbSGzJCNXaQaxehdGaX